Exploring The Effective Stereopsis Treatment Options

Stereopsis, also known as depth perception, is the ability of the brain to interpret the slight differences in the images received by each eye in order to perceive depth in the visual field. This ability is crucial for tasks such as navigating the environment, hand-eye coordination, and overall spatial awareness. However, some individuals may experience issues with stereopsis, which can affect their daily activities and quality of life. Fortunately, there are several treatment options available to improve or restore stereopsis.

One common treatment for improving stereopsis is vision therapy. This form of therapy involves a series of visual exercises and activities designed to strengthen the eye muscles and improve coordination between the eyes. Vision therapy can be particularly beneficial for individuals with amblyopia (lazy eye) or strabismus (crossed eyes), as these conditions often result in impaired stereopsis. By addressing the underlying vision problems, vision therapy can help patients develop binocular vision and improve their depth perception.

Another effective treatment for stereopsis is the use of stereoscopic vision training. This training involves the use of specialized equipment, such as 3D glasses or virtual reality headsets, to present images to each eye separately. By training the brain to interpret these separate images and fuse them into a single, three-dimensional image, stereoscopic vision training can help improve stereopsis in individuals with visual deficits. This form of treatment is often used in combination with vision therapy to maximize results.

In some cases, optometrists may recommend the use of prism glasses to improve stereopsis. Prism glasses are specially designed lenses that bend light rays before they enter the eye, helping to correct alignment issues and enhance binocular vision. By adjusting the angle of the prisms, optometrists can customize the glasses to meet the specific needs of each patient and improve their depth perception. While prism glasses may not be suitable for all individuals with stereopsis issues, they can be a valuable treatment option for those who can benefit from them.

For individuals with more severe stereopsis deficits, surgical intervention may be necessary. Strabismus surgery, also known as eye muscle surgery, can be performed to correct the misalignment of the eyes and improve binocular vision. By adjusting the position of the eye muscles, surgeons can help restore normal eye alignment and improve depth perception in patients with strabismus. While surgery is typically considered a last resort for treating stereopsis, it can be a highly effective option for individuals who have not seen improvement with other treatments.

In addition to these traditional treatment options, emerging technologies such as virtual reality (VR) are also being explored as potential tools for improving stereopsis. VR technology can be used to create realistic 3D environments that stimulate the brain and enhance depth perception. By immersing patients in these virtual worlds, therapists can help them practice visual discrimination tasks and improve their ability to perceive depth. While more research is needed to fully understand the effectiveness of VR for stereopsis treatment, early studies have shown promising results.
